| Strain number | NIES-4280 | |||
|---|---|---|---|---|
| Phylum | Heterokontophyta | |||
| Class | Bacillariophyceae | |||
| Scientific name | Mayamaea pseudoterrestris Tuji & H.Yamaguchi | |||
| Synonym | ||||
| Former name | Navicula pelliculosa (Kützing) Hilse | |||
| Common name | Pennate diatom | |||
| Locality (Date of collection) | Connecticut, USA | |||
| Latitude / Longitude | ||||
| Habitat (Isolation source) | Terrestrial | |||
| History | < UTEX (2019); | |||
| Isolator (Date of isolation) | Lewin, R. A. (1951-**-**) | |||
| Identified by | Tuji, Akihiro (Reidentify) | |||
| State of strain | Cryopreservation; Unialgal; Clonal; Axenic[2019 June] | |||
|
Culture condition (Preculture condition) |
Medium:
CSi
Temperature: 20 C Light intensity: 24 µmol photons/m2/sec, L/D cycle: 10L:14D Duration: 1 M |
|||
| Gene information | Whole-genome ( BROI00000000 ) , 18S rRNA ( LC648451 ) , rbcL ( LC648448 ) | |||
| Cell size (min - max) | ||||
| Organization | Unicellular | |||
| Characteristics | Test strain for algal growth inhibition test (OECD TG201) ; Authentic strain (Tuji et al. 2021) ; Type specimen (NIES-50023, Isotype) ; Genome decoded strain (Suzuki et al. 2022) | |||
| Other strain no. |
Other collection strain no. : UTEX 661
Other strain no. : 22 |
|||
| Remarks | Cryopreserved; Axenic | |||
